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Size: Larger windows typically cost more due to increased material and labor.
- Number of Windows: More windows mean higher overall costs, but bulk installations can sometimes offer discounts.
- Type of Vinyl: Higher-quality vinyl can be more expensive but offers better durability and energy efficiency.
- Window Style: Different styles, such as double-hung, casement, or bay windows, have varying costs.
- Glass Type: Options like double-pane, triple-pane, and low-E glass can affect the price.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Bellevue, WA, can vary depending on the contractor and the complexity of the installation.
- Additional Features: Extras like custom colors, grids, or special hardware can increase costs.
- Old Window Removal: Removing and disposing of old windows can add to the total exp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Bellevue, WA) |
---|---|
Single Window Installation | $300 - $700 |
Double-Hung Vinyl Window | $450 - $900 |
Casement Vinyl Window | $500 - $1,000 |
Bay or Bow Vinyl Window | $1,200 - $3,500 |
Double-Pane Glass Upgrade | $50 - $100 per window |
Triple-Pane Glass Upgrade | $100 - $150 per window |
Low-E Glass Installation | $50 - $80 per window |
Old Window Removal and Disposal | $50 - $150 per window |
Custom Color or Finish | $50 - $100 per window |
Installation Labor | $100 - $300 per window |
